I've read that some mapmakers put deliberate mistakes into their
maps so they can catch copyists -- who'd make the same few mistakes
out of the many thousands of details in a map? If so, you may
be asking them to change one of their signatures, which may explain
their reluctance to fix it. Alternatively, they may just be
$GENERIC_INSULT.
